Many people want to lose weight, and despite claims for quick fat burning pills and powders, the best way to lose weight is still through proper diet and exercise. Exercise does more than just maintain physical fitness though. Working out can also help build healthy bone density, muscle strength, and joint mobility. It can also reduce general health risks, boost the immune system, and help with depression and insomnia. Whether trying to lose weight, or improve muscle mass, working out is always a good idea to help promote a healthy body and mind.
